Finding reliable movers
So, with that in mind – search for a good moving company which can handle moving on short notice. But bear in mind, you don’t have a lot of time to do extensive research on moving companies; as you usually would. At the same time, though, you want to hire someone reputable, but not too expensive. Plus, you’ll have to think about the moving company’s schedule as well. Depending on when you need to relocate during the given year, you may have trouble finding movers with a free slot to fit you in.

Most people tend to move during the summer months!
For example, the warmer summer months are generally when most business in the moving industry occurs. That’s something you’ll have to consider as you plan the logistics of your move. But on the other hand, you shouldn’t go for the first moving company that has a free schedule. You should get at least a couple of quotes first, to make sure that you’re not getting “a rotten” deal. Be practical while packing for moving on short notice
All the chores related to moving can become a difficulty if you don’t approach them the right way. But among those, packing is the trickiest part if you’re not careful. And especially when you’re moving on short notice, people tend to overlook important stuff. Which is why we want to urge you not to underestimate packing – plenty of people who’ve moved have, to their detriment. For starters, even if you’ve got a short period to do it all in, you need to remain systematic. Start by making an inventory of all the things you’re going to move. This may take an entire afternoon, but it’ll save you time down the line.

Sell or donate all the things you don’t need!
Are you done with that? Good! Now you can proceed to get rid of stuff you can’t or shouldn’t bring. Yes, that won’t be easy – we all get attached to our possessions. But when you’re about to attempt moving on short notice, you need to cut down on both time and costs, which means donating, selling, or throwing out things that don’t have a place in your new household. If you do this on time, and right – packing won’t be a hassle even for a long distance move. Just make sure you don’t take more stuff than you can realistically use.
